We are seeking a compassionate and dedicated Caregiver to provide personalized care to a young lady on the spectrum. The ideal candidate will have experience in caregiving, a deep understanding of the needs of individuals with intellectual disabilities, and a genuine commitment to enhancing the quality of life of the person in their care.
Key Responsibilities:
- Personal Care: Assist with daily living activities such as bathing, dressing, grooming, toileting, and mobility.
- Client led pace and patience in completion of all tasks.
- Medication Management: Administer prescribed medications and ensure proper adherence to medication schedules.
- Meal Preparation: Plan and prepare nutritious meals in accordance with dietary restrictions and preferences.
- Household Management: Assist with light housekeeping tasks, including laundry, cleaning, and organizing the living space.
- Transportation: Provide transportation to appointments, social activities, and other outings as needed.
- Companionship: Offer emotional support and engage in meaningful activities to enhance the client's social and mental well-being.
- Safety Monitoring: Ensure the client's safety by preventing falls, monitoring for potential hazards, and providing supervision as needed.
- Documentation: Maintain accurate records of care provided, including daily logs, incident reports, and updates to care plans.
- Collaboration: Work closely with healthcare providers, family members, and other caregivers to ensure comprehensive care.
